Pedestrian Simulation

Predictions on pedestrian flows based on human behaviour models to improve building efficiency, accessibility, safety, and user comfort

Mobility simulation can be very useful to predict human behaviour in buildings with high human density such as stations, hospitals, shopping centers, schools, museums, or production sites. Information on the flow of pedestrian can also be combined with information on public transports, vehicular traffic, movement of goods, social connections, and access to public spaces.
Imagine to start the design of a new train-station, a place where every minute really counts. Imagine to have information on the quantity, cadence, and position of in- and out-coming trains, buses, bikes, and pedestrians. Imagine to be able to simulate the natural pedestrian flow in that empty space without having a building design in mind yet. By observing how people would naturally move in that space you can start to think about architectural solutions that will contain an innate efficiency. Stepwise you can then start to integrate additional functional elements like ticket-desks, shops, and entrances, and gradually verify the interaction between the architectural solution and the behaviour of the future users.
